草庐IT

Java ScriptEngine 支持的语言

全部标签

C语言实现-数组移位,前移,后移,整体移动

提示:本文讲解有关数组后移前移的操作,以及具体的题目应用.文章目录一、数组前移二、数组后移二、数组整体移动题目:有n个整数,使前面各数顺序向后移m个位置,最后m个数变成最前面m个数总结一、数组前移数组前移一个元素分为三部,假设为数组为1,2,3,4,5,6,7,8,9,移动后的数应该为2,3,4,5,6,7,8,9,1将要被因数组移动干掉的元素,这里就是1存放在临时变量里将数组整体向前移动,其实应该是让后一个元素给到前面一个在将临时变量中存放的元素,也就是1,放在数组的末尾即可注意,这里整体向前移动,需要正序遍历数组,因为如果是逆序遍历,那么第一次遍历结束,后面的8就没了,直接变成了9,依次类

winserver2016远程桌面出现函数不支持情况解决

·问题:虚拟机安装了Windowsserver2016,已经打开了远程桌面与设置了防火墙入站规则增加对应的端口,但是在测试远程的时候一直无法连接成功服务端winserver2016: 允许远程连接到此计算机,但是不要勾选“仅允许运行使用网络级别身份验证的远程桌面的计算机连接”。客户端:感谢作者原文章:关于远程Windowsserver2016远程提示“要求的函数不受支持”的解决办法-funkergx-博客园win+R输入gpedit.msc使用gpedit.msc打开组策略,依次展开计算机配置、管理模板、Windows组件、远程桌面服务、远程桌面会话、安全,双击右侧子菜单中的“要求使用网络级别

c# - automapper 缺少类型映射配置或不支持的映射。?

错误Missingtypemapconfigurationorunsupportedmapping.Mappingtypes:Cities_C391BA93C06F35100522AFBFA8F6BF3823972C9E97D5A49783829A4E90A03F00->IEnumerable`1System.Data.Entity.DynamicProxies.Cities_C391BA93C06F35100522AFBFA8F6BF3823972C9E97D5A49783829A4E90A03F00->System.Collections.Generic.IEnumerable`1

c# - 在哪里可以找到 C# 语言规范?

在哪里可以找到各种C#语言的规范?(编辑:看起来人们投了反对票,因为你可以“谷歌”这个,但是,我的初衷是用谷歌上找不到的信息给出答案。我接受了谷歌搜索结果最好的答案,因为它们与尚未为VS付费的人相关) 最佳答案 Microsoft'sversion(可能是你想要的)Theformalstandardisedversions(通过ECMA,创建只是为了让他们可以说它是由某个外部机构“标准化”的。尽管ECMA“标准”实际上是“插入现金,出售标准”)。FurtherECMAstandards

c# - 当您说 C# 是面向组件的语言时,这意味着什么?

我前段时间学习了Java。我只是厌倦了Java,过了一段时间又回到了C++。我认为C#类似于Java。在阅读了一些有关C#的文章后,我对C#和Java之间相似性的假设并不正确。我在C#中发现了许多我喜欢在Java中看到的强大概念。不管怎样,除了一件事,我读到的大部分内容对我来说都是有意义的。我一直听说C#是面向组件的语言!维基百科对这个概念真的毫无用处。当您说C#是面向组件的语言时,简单来说是什么意思?!一个简单的例子将不胜感激。 最佳答案 我相信这里的其他人能够更好地解释什么是面向组件的语言(如果他们不会,应该在互联网上进行彻底的

c# - 是否可以强制自动属性使用只读支持字段?

我的项目包含大量具有属性的类,这些属性的支持字段标记为只读,因为它们仅在构造时设置。就风格而言,我喜欢使用自动属性,因为它消除了很多样板代码并鼓励使用属性成员而不是支持字段。但是,当使用自动属性时,我失去了支持字段的“只读性”。我知道当以这种方式标记字段时,编译器/运行时能够利用一些性能增强功能,因此我希望能够将我的自动属性标记为只读,如下所示:[ReadOnly]publicstringLastName{get;}而不是privatereadonlystring_LastName;publicstringLastName{get{return_LastName;}}是否已经有某种机制

c# - 如何创建具有空值支持的结构?

我是C#新手。在C#中,我无法将结构的值设置为null如何创建支持null值的结构? 最佳答案 通过使用GenericNullable类来包装结构和值类型,可以使它们可以为空。例如:Nullablenum1=null;C#通过在类型后添加问号为此提供了一种语言功能:int?num1=null;同样适用于任何值类型,包括结构。MSDN说明:NullableTypes(c#) 关于c#-如何创建具有空值支持的结构?,我们在StackOverflow上找到一个类似的问题:

c# - 扩展 C# .NET 应用程序 - 是否构建自定义脚本语言?

我需要为我的C#程序构建一个脚本接口(interface),对嵌入式固件进行系统级测试。我的应用程序包含与设备完全交互的库。有单独的库用于启动操作、获取输出和跟踪成功/失败。我的应用程序还有一个GUI,用于管理多个设备并分配许多要运行的脚本。对于测试人员(非程序员,但技术),我需要提供一个脚本接口(interface),使他们能够提出不同的测试场景并运行它们。他们只是调用我的API,然后将结果返回给我的程序(通过/失败和消息)。我想要的一个非常基本的例子:TURN_POWER_ONTUNE_FREQUENCYfrequencyWAIT5IFGET_FREQUENCY==frequenc

c# - 为什么 Visual Studio 项目仅限于一种语言?

这个问题的灵感来自于这个问题:InwhatareasdoesF#make"absolutenosenseinusing"?理论上,应该可以在单个项目中使用任何.NET支持的语言。因为每个东西都应该编译成IL代码,然后链接成一个程序集。一些好处包括能够将F#用于一个类,其中F#更适合实现其功能,而C#用于另一个类。我是否忽略了一些阻止此类设置的技术限制? 最佳答案 一个项目仅限于一种语言,因为在幕后,一个项目只不过是一个MSBuild脚本,它调用一个命令行编译器从“包含”的各种源代码文件生成程序集项目文件夹。每种语言都有不同的编译器(

C# 作为第一门语言?

关闭。这个问题是opinion-based.它目前不接受答案。想要改进这个问题?更新问题,以便editingthispost可以用事实和引用来回答它.关闭9年前。Improvethisquestion是否可以在不了解它结合的其他三种语言的情况下将C#作为第一门计算机语言来学习?我在不了解c的情况下学习了objective-c,但假设我对C#或任何其他语言一无所知,是否可以作为第一语言来学习?